Dileep’s acquittal in 2017 assault case

In 2017, a well-known actress was kidnapped and assaulted in a transferring automotive. Just a few months after the assault, Dileep was discovered to have hyperlinks to the primary accused, Pulsar Suni, and was arrested by the police. He acquired bail and continued to work within the Malayalam movie business after that.

The case partly contributed to the creation of Girls in Cinema Collective and the formation of the Hema Committee. The case’s trial started in a periods courtroom in Ernakulam in 2018 and continued for eight years. On 8 December 2025, Dileep and three others had been acquitted within the case, whereas six others had been discovered responsible.

Dileep’s acquittal has left the movie business cut up. The Kerala authorities introduced their plan to enchantment towards the decision in increased courts.
